Cross-polarization reduction in a directive ultra-wideband antenna using electromagnetic polarization filter
An electromagnetic polarization filter (EMPF) is designed to reduce the cross-polarization of a directive ultra-wideband (UWB) antenna. The filter is a rectangular cap with solid metal sheets on two sides and printed metal strips on the top and other sides. This cap increases the height of the whole structure by 5 mm while reducing the maximum cross-polarization level by 7 dB over the frequency band 8 GHz to 11 GHz. The resulting antenna has a maximum cross-polarization level of -20 dB over the frequency band.
